College Internship Opportunities :

The college provides some internship opportunities, especially for ECE students. Companies like TCS and Wipro visit the campus for recruitment. However, the number of internships could be increased to provide more students with practical experience. Networking with seniors and faculty can help you land a good internship.

Course Information :

The BE Electronics and Communication Engineering (ECE) course at Rajiv Gandhi Institute of Technology is decent. The curriculum is updated, and the faculty is experienced. However, some students feel that more practical application and industry exposure would be beneficial. Overall, it's a good option if you're looking for a solid foundation in ECE.

Fee Structure :

The fee structure for BE Electronics and Communication Engineering is around ₹62,543 per year. It's pretty standard compared to other private engineering colleges in Bangalore. While not the cheapest, it's manageable, and many students opt for education loans to cover the costs. Keep an eye out for any scholarship opportunities to ease the financial burden.

Faculty :

Some of the faculty members are really knowledgeable and helpful, especially in the ECE department. They're always ready to clear doubts and provide guidance. However, a few professors could improve their teaching methods to make the lectures more engaging. Overall, the faculty is supportive and dedicated to helping students succeed.

Campus Details :

The campus is compact, with the dental college, hospital, engineering college, and hostels all in one place. It feels a bit crowded, and there isn't much open space for sports or relaxation. The labs are well-equipped, though some equipment is old but still functional. The library is good, but the lack of Wi-Fi is a major drawback.
